What is a CDR file and what do I need to use to open it?

cdr is a graphics and text saving format for vector files. It is a CorelDraw-specific file storage format. Therefore, it can generally be opened with CorelDraw software. Adobe Illustrator software can also open files in this format, but it is easy to cause deletions.

CorelDraw is generally used for the drawing and typesetting of vector graphics, such as trademarks, album typesetting, manual vector drawing and color separation output, and many other fields.
